Factors Affecting Cost

Concrete retaining wall installation involves constructing a durable structure to hold back soil and prevent erosion. The scope and complexity of the project can vary based on design preferences, site conditions, and intended use. Understanding the typical components and considerations can help in planning and budgeting for this type of project.

  • Materials: Commonly used materials include poured concrete, precast blocks, and reinforced concrete panels, each offering different aesthetic and structural qualities.
  • Size and Scope: The size of the wall, height, length, and design complexity influence overall project scope and material requirements.
  • Labor Complexity: Factors such as site accessibility, excavation requirements, and wall design impact labor time and difficulty.
  • Permitting: Local regulations may require permits for retaining wall construction, especially for taller structures or certain site conditions.
  • Additional Features: Options such as drainage systems, decorative finishes, or integrated steps may be included to enhance functionality and appearance.

Project Size Considerations

Scope/Size Typical Range
Small retaining wall (up to 3 feet high) $1,500 - $3,000
Medium retaining wall (3 to 6 feet high) $3,000 - $8,000
Large retaining wall (over 6 feet high) $8,000 - $20,000
Complex or reinforced structures $20,000 and above

Costs can vary based on site conditions, materials, and project complexity.
